Green Chile N Cheese Biscuit

Bring a Southwestern twist to your breakfast table with these flaky, cheesy Green Chile N Cheese Biscuits! This quick and easy recipe combines the comforting richness of sharp cheddar cheese with the smoky, slightly spicy kick of roasted green chiles, creating a flavor-packed biscuit that’s perfect as a standalone snack or a savory side dish. The secret to their tender, buttery layers lies in the use of cold, cubed butter and a delicate touch when mixing the dough. Ready in under 30 minutes, these biscuits are brushed with melted butter for an optional finishing touch that adds a golden sheen and irresistible flavor. Serve them warm straight out of the oven, and pair with soups, stews, or scrambled eggs for a hearty, crowd-pleasing meal. Perfect for brunch gatherings, potlucks, or weekday indulgence, these biscuits deliver comfort with a spicy edge.

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:12 mins
Total Time:27 mins
Servings: 8

Ingredients

  • 2 cups All-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on Ba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 cup Unsalted butter, cold and cubed
  • 0.75 cup Buttermilk, cold
  • 0.5 cup Green chiles, roasted, peeled, and diced
  • 0.75 cup S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 2 tablespoons Optional: Butter, melted (for brushing)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

Step 2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.

Step 3

Add the cold, cubed butter to the flour mixture. Use a pastry cutter or your fingers to cut the butter into the flour until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.

Step 4

Stir in the diced green chiles and shredded cheddar cheese until evenly distributed.

Step 5

Pour in the cold buttermilk and gently mix until the dough just comes together. Be careful not to overmix.

Step 6

Transfer the dough onto a lightly floured surface and knead it gently 3-4 times to bring it together. Pat or roll the dough into a 1-inch thick rectangle.

Step 7

Use a biscuit cutter or a round glass to cut out biscuits. Gather the scraps, reshape, and cut additional biscuits until dough is used up.

Step 8

Place the biscuits on the prepared baking sheet about 1 inch apart.

Step 9

Bake in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es, or until the tops are golden brown.

Step 10

Optional: Brush the tops of the hot biscuits with melted butter for extra flavor.

Step 11

Serve warm and enjoy!
